Top Ten Songs About Smoking
1. Brownsville Station-"Smokin' in the Boys Room"
Brownsville Station's school rebel anthem "Smokin' in the Boys Room" has been covered by many other rock musicians who remember their first taste of anarchy in a sneaked drag of a Marlboro. The best part of the song (and probably why it maintains freshness despite aging) is how Brownsville Station know smoking is bad and against the rules, but they just don't care: "Smokin' in the boys' room (Yes indeed, I was)/Smokin' in the boys' room/Now, teacher, don't you fill me up with your rules/But everybody knows that smokin' ain't allowed in school."
